Own a piece of history that chronicles a pivotal moment in Argentina's culture.Esto #407 from November 1993 dives deep into the tumultuous stories and the darker side of society, featuring heart-wrenching articles that capture the zeitgeist of the time. Experience narratives about the brutal realities confronting ordinary citizens, with tales ranging from a young girl's tragic fate on the provincial roads of Santa Fe to the chilling accounts of journalists facing dangers on the job. The magazine also highlights the life of Marcelo Grimoldi, a victim of extortion kidnapping, alongside the grim discovery of journalist Mario Osvaldo Bonino’s body in the Riachuelo, emphasizing the peril journalists faced during this tumultuous period.
Furthermore, the pages reveal shocking accounts of football-related violence, include police stories that challenge perceptions, and touch upon human tragedies and the inexplicable. With contributions from notable figures like Omar Aymeric and stories of crime woven into the fabric of the publication, Esto #407 serves as both a captivating read and a critical reflection on a critical time in Argentina's socio-political landscape.
